Post-Impressionism

Published to accompany the Royal Academy of Arts’ landmark 1979–80 exhibition, this richly illustrated volume explores the revolutionary period from the 1880s to around 1910—a time that bridged Impressionism and Cubism.

Featuring over 400 paintings from across Europe, including France, Belgium, Holland, Germany, and beyond, the book highlights the influence of French Post-Impressionism on artists throughout the continent. Scholarly essays by leading art historians provide insightful context, while a detailed chronology links the art to broader cultural and political movements of the time.

Includes 46 color plates and approximately 400 black-and-white illustrations. A foundational reference for anyone interested in Post-Impressionist art.
